Ahmedabad’s Shahibaug, Mithakhali underpasses to be closed temporarily due to railway works

Key traffic routes in Ahmedabad will face disruptions over the coming days as railway track maintenance work prompts phased and temporary closures of the Shahibaug and Mithakhali underpasses.
According to officials, the Shahibaug Underpass will remain partially closed in phases from March 19 to March 28, between 12 noon and 5 pm, and again from midnight to 5 am. Meanwhile, the Mithakhali Underpass will be completely shut for traffic from midnight to 5 am between March 19 and March 21.
Authorities have arranged alternative routes to manage traffic flow. Vehicles travelling from Delhi Gate towards Airport and Gandhinagar will be diverted via the Riverfront, while those coming from Girdharnagar and Asarwa towards Shahibaug Annexe will follow revised routes. For the Mithakhali closure, traffic will be rerouted along Ashram Road.
The closures come at a time when traffic pressure on the Shahibaug Underpass has already increased following the shutdown of Subhash Bridge.
Commuters have expressed concern over repeated disruptions, noting that the underpass had been closed multiple times in the past month.
